In the 2020-2021 academic year, 7 students earned a associate's degree in agricultural business from Butler CC. About 43% of these graduates were women and the other 57% were men.
The majority of associate's degree recipients in this major at Butler CC are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 71% of students fell into this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Butler Community College with a associate's in agricultural business.
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
---|---|
Asian | 0 |
Black or African American | 0 |
Hispanic or Latino | 1 |
White | 5 |
Non-Resident Aliens | 0 |
Other Races | 1 |
